哈希游戏挂机,探索游戏中的哈希世界哈希游戏挂机
本文目录导读:
嗯,用户让我写一篇关于“哈希游戏挂机”的文章,首先我得弄清楚什么是哈希游戏,哈希通常指的是哈希函数,但在游戏里可能有不同的应用,挂机游戏可能是指那些需要玩家长时间点击或按动按钮的游戏,但用户提到的“哈希游戏挂机”可能是指利用哈希算法来实现的游戏机制,或者可能是指哈希在游戏中的某种应用,比如随机事件生成。 用户要求写一个标题和内容,内容不少于3032个字,我需要先确定标题,可能需要吸引人,同时准确反映文章内容,哈希游戏挂机:探索游戏中的哈希世界”这样的标题,既点明了主题,又有一定的吸引力。 需要涵盖哈希游戏挂机的各个方面,解释哈希函数的基本概念,这样读者能理解基础,讨论哈希函数在游戏中的应用,比如随机事件生成、角色创建、资源分配等,深入分析哈希挂机的特点,比如随机性、不可预测性,以及这些特性如何影响游戏体验。 可以探讨哈希挂机的优缺点,比如优点是增加了游戏的公平性和随机性,缺点可能是玩家难以预测结果,影响游戏的策略性,结合实际案例,英雄联盟》中的技能CD时间计算,或者《原神》中的角色获取机制,说明哈希函数的应用。 总结哈希挂机在游戏设计中的重要性,强调其在平衡性和公平性上的作用,同时指出未来的发展方向,比如更复杂的哈希算法应用。 在写作过程中,要注意逻辑清晰,结构合理,每个部分都要有足够的解释和例子支持,语言要通俗易懂,避免过于技术化的术语,让读者容易理解,字数方面,需要确保内容足够详细,达到3032字的要求,可能需要扩展每个部分的内容,加入更多的分析和例子。 这篇文章需要全面介绍哈希游戏挂机的概念、应用、优缺点,并结合实际游戏案例进行分析,最后总结其在游戏设计中的作用,这样既满足了用户的要求,又提供了有价值的信息。
在游戏开发的漫长历史中,哈希函数始终扮演着一个特殊的角色,它不仅仅是简单的数学运算,更是游戏设计者们用来创造公平、随机且不可预测的游戏机制的重要工具,而“哈希游戏挂机”这一概念,正是哈希函数在游戏中的典型应用,什么是哈希游戏挂机?它又如何在游戏世界中发挥作用?本文将带您一起探索这个有趣的话题。
哈希函数的 basics
哈希函数,全称是Message-Digest algorithm,简称MD算法,是一种将任意长度的输入数据,经过处理后产生固定长度的输出的算法,这个固定长度的输出通常被称为哈希值、指纹或摘要,哈希函数具有以下几个关键特性:
- 确定性:相同的输入总是返回相同的哈希值。
- 快速计算:给定输入,能够快速计算出哈希值。
- 不可逆性:给定哈希值,无法有效地还原出原始输入。
- 分布均匀:哈希值在输出空间中分布均匀,没有明显的规律。
这些特性使得哈希函数在密码学、数据存储、数据 integrity验证等领域得到了广泛应用。
哈希函数在游戏中的应用
在游戏设计中,哈希函数虽然没有直接的视觉反馈,但其特性为游戏设计提供了许多可能性,以下是哈希函数在游戏中的几个典型应用:
-
随机事件生成
哈希函数可以用来生成看似随机但实际上可重复的数值,游戏中的随机事件(如掉落物品、技能触发等)可以通过哈希函数来实现,游戏设计师可以设置一个种子值,通过哈希函数计算出一个随机数,从而决定事件的发生。 -
角色创建与分配
在需要随机分配资源或角色的任务中,哈希函数可以确保分配的公平性,游戏中的角色创建界面,可以通过哈希函数为每位玩家生成一个唯一的ID,确保每个玩家都有平等的机会被选中。 -
资源分配与任务分配
在多人在线游戏中,哈希函数可以用来公平分配游戏资源或任务,游戏中的任务分配可以通过哈希函数计算出每个玩家的优先级,从而实现公平的资源分配。 -
防止数据泄露
在需要保护玩家数据的安全性游戏中,哈希函数可以用来保护玩家的个人信息,游戏中的登录验证可以通过哈希函数对玩家密码进行加密,确保即使数据泄露,也无法轻易破解原始密码。
哈希游戏挂机的特点与优势
哈希游戏挂机作为一种基于哈希函数的游戏机制,具有以下几个显著特点:
-
不可预测性
哈希函数的不可逆性使得游戏结果无法被预测,玩家无法通过已知的哈希值来推断出原始输入,从而避免了被针对性操作的可能性。 -
公平性
哈希函数的确定性使得游戏结果的公平性得到了保障,只要游戏设计师设置相同的种子值,游戏结果就会是相同的。 -
随机性
哈希函数的输出在固定输入下是随机的,这使得游戏结果具有极大的不确定性,增加了游戏的趣味性。 -
不可重复性
哈希函数的不可逆性使得游戏结果无法被重复操作,玩家无法通过多次点击或按动按钮来影响游戏结果。
哈希游戏挂机的优缺点
-
优点
- 增强公平性:通过哈希函数的确定性,游戏结果可以被严格控制,确保每个玩家都有平等的机会。
- 增加随机性:哈希函数的不可预测性使得游戏结果更加随机,增加了游戏的趣味性。
- 防止针对性操作:哈希函数的不可逆性使得游戏结果无法被针对性操作,减少了玩家的恶意行为。
-
缺点
- 降低玩家控制感:哈希游戏挂机的结果往往是由系统控制的,玩家无法通过自己的操作来影响结果,降低了玩家的控制感。
- 增加游戏复杂性:哈希函数的计算通常较为复杂,可能会增加游戏的复杂性,影响玩家的游戏体验。
- 可能导致资源浪费:在需要频繁计算哈希值的情况下,可能会导致资源浪费,影响游戏的运行效率。
哈希游戏挂机的实际案例
为了更好地理解哈希游戏挂机的实际应用,我们来看几个实际案例:
-
《英雄联盟》中的技能CD时间计算
在《英雄联盟》中,技能的冷却时间(CD)是一个重要的游戏机制,游戏设计师通过哈希函数来计算技能CD时间,确保每个技能的CD时间都是随机且不可预测的,这种机制使得游戏更加公平,减少了玩家对技能CD时间的操控。 -
《原神》中的角色获取机制
在《原神》中,角色获取机制是一个非常重要的游戏机制,游戏设计师通过哈希函数来计算玩家的抽卡结果,确保每个玩家都有平等的机会抽取到 desired 角色,这种机制不仅增加了游戏的公平性,还提升了玩家的参与感。 -
《使命召唤》中的武器掉落机制
在《使命召唤》中,武器掉落机制是一个非常吸引人的游戏机制,游戏设计师通过哈希函数来计算武器掉落的概率,确保掉落机制的公平性和随机性,这种机制使得玩家在游戏中体验更加丰富,增加了游戏的趣味性。
哈希游戏挂机的未来发展方向
尽管哈希游戏挂机在游戏设计中具有许多优点,但其缺点也不容忽视,游戏设计师们需要在哈希游戏挂机的应用中找到平衡点,既要利用哈希函数的特性来增强游戏的公平性和随机性,又要确保玩家的控制感和游戏体验,以下是一些未来发展方向:
-
结合其他机制
哈希函数可以与其他游戏机制结合使用,例如将哈希函数与物理模拟相结合,创造出更加复杂和有趣的游戏机制。 -
优化哈希函数的性能
哈希函数的计算通常较为复杂,游戏设计师需要不断优化哈希函数的性能,以确保游戏的运行效率。 -
引入动态哈希函数
在游戏后期,可以引入动态哈希函数,根据游戏的进展和玩家的行为来调整哈希函数的参数,从而实现更加个性化的游戏体验。
哈希游戏挂机作为一种基于哈希函数的游戏机制,为游戏设计者们提供了一种新的思路,通过哈希函数的不可预测性、公平性和随机性,游戏设计师们可以创造出更加公平、随机且有趣的游戏机制,哈希游戏挂机也存在一些缺点,需要游戏设计师们在实际应用中进行权衡,随着哈希函数技术的不断发展,哈希游戏挂机的应用也将更加广泛,为游戏设计带来更多的可能性。
哈希游戏挂机,探索游戏中的哈希世界哈希游戏挂机,



发表评论